School Breakfast Program (SBP)Fruit Yogurt Cups

Nutritionally balanced, affordable breakfasts are provided to students each school day.  School breakfast menus must meet meal requirements specific to the age/grade group of students served.  Schools may choose to serve school breakfasts in a traditional, cafeteria-style model, as well as offering alternative delivery models such as breakfast in the classroom or grab & go breakfast.  


Since Baltimore County Public Schools is operating under the Community Eligibility Provision (CEP) districtwide, all students receive breakfast for free.  Schools operate grab & go breakfast, serving students breakfast before school that can be consumed before or during morning classes or during a break.

Lunch BoxesNational School Lunch Program (NSLP)

Nutritionally balanced, affordable lunches are provided to students each school day.  School lunch menus must meet meal requirements specific to the age/grade group of students served.  

Since Baltimore County Public Schools is operating under the Community Eligibility Provision (CEP) districtwide, all students receive lunch for free. 

Eligible sites may apply for and operate, if selected, a fresh fruit & vegetable program (FFVP), integrating a variety of fresh, local produce samplings and nutrition education within the school day.  Find additional information about FFVP here.
